JC Acosta to preside VIMN Americas

Juan (“JC”) Acosta, currently EVP, and Chief Operating Officer of VIMN Americas, will be promoted to president of VIMN Americas, effective January 3rd, 2020. Acosta will report to David Lynn, President & CEO of VIMN. 

Lynn commented: “JC’s understanding of the entertainment industry, strategic expertise and deep knowledge of both VIMN and the international television market make him ideally suited for his new role. JC’s tenure with VIMN and impact on the business to date will ensure both a seamless leadership transition and a continued growth trajectory for our Americas operations. JC played a key role in the transformation of the VIMN Americas business, integrating and managing Telefe and Porta dos Fundos, and is ideally equipped to take VIMN Americas through its next stage of growth.”

Acosta commented: “I couldn’t be more excited to take on this role. It’s been my privilege to partner with Pier during such a transformational period for our business. The VIMN Americas team is an expert in driving value through its ability to adapt to the ever-changing media landscape through innovation, content entrepreneurship, and passion. I look forward to continuing to work with them and our partners as we create and distribute winning content, products, and experiences for the region.”

In his new role, Acosta will be responsible for VIMN operations for Latin America, spanning Argentina, Brazil, Colombia, Mexico, as well as Canada and the US Hispanic market. He will be tasked with the ongoing expansion of VIMN’s portfolio and products in the region, including its multiplatform business, global studio and content distribution and licensing efforts and TV channels (MTV, Nickelodeon, Comedy Central, Paramount Channel, and Telefe, Argentina’s leading free-to-air broadcaster) and digital portfolio (including Porta Dos Fundos).

Acosta has been with VIMN for 13 years, having first joined the company in 2007 as VP and Chief Financial Officer of VIMN Americas.
